About Developing Potential, Inc.
Developing Potential, Inc. (DPI) is a nationally accredited CARF Day Habilitation program that has proudly provided support services to adults with developmental disabilities in Jackson County since 1993.
Our mission is centered around building strengths, fostering independence, changing lives, and developing potential. We are passionate about creating opportunities for the individuals we support and are looking for team members who share that same passion.
